To clarify, the owners of properties described below were <br />already annexed to the City of Eugene in 2010, following voluntary application by the property owners <br />and subsequent approval by City Council. State law and local code requires that properties (or <br />“territories”) that are annexed to cities be withdrawn from special service districts through a separate <br />process. When properties are withdrawn from special districts following annexation to the City, the City <br />assumes responsibility for providing services (e.g. fire protection, water service, etc.) formerly provided <br />by the special districts. The special districts affected by action in this particular case are Lane Rural Fire <br />District, River Road Park & Recreation District, and River Road Water District. <br /> <br />Withdrawals come before the council on an annual basis. Properties annexed during the previous year <br />are batched together to facilitate this process. The 2011 batch contains the two annexations approved in <br />2010 (for a total of six tax lots): <br /> <br /> <br /> <br />Kirk Giudici and Jade Elms—195 Lindner Lane; (City File A 10-01, Effective May 24, 2010) <br /> <br /> <br />Airport Industrial Properties—29536, 29538, 29540, 29548, and 29550 Airport Road; (City File <br />A 10-02, Effective November 3, 2010) <br /> <br />The council is asked to determine whether the withdrawals meet the approval criterion established by <br />state law and local code; the only approval criterion is that the City “shall determine whether the <br />withdrawal is in the best interest of the city” (EC 9.7835).
